The Kreidler Martinique 125 was a single cylinder, four-stroke standard produced by Kreidler between 2009 and 2011.

Engine[edit | edit source]

The engine was a liquid cooled single cylinder, four-stroke. Fuel was supplied via a overhead cams (ohc).

Drive[edit | edit source]

The bike has a automatic transmission.

Chassis[edit | edit source]

It came with a 100/80-16 front tire and a 110/80-16 rear tire. Stopping was achieved via single disc in the front and a single disc in the rear. The front suspension was a telescopic fork while the rear was equipped with a hydraulic shock absorbers (adjustable). The Martinique 125 was fitted with a 2.91 Gallon (11.00 Liters) fuel tank. The bike weighed just 304.24 pounds (138.0 Kg). The wheelbase was 55.12 inches (1400 mm) long.
